Mari Energies Announces Gas Discovery in Balochistan

Mari Energies Limited has announced a new gas discovery at the Tibri-1 exploratory well in the Kalchas South Block, located in Dera Bugti district of Balochistan, according to a notice sent to the Pakistan Stock Exchange (PSX).

The Kalchas South joint venture is operated by United Energy Pakistan Limited (UEPL) with a 46% working interest, while Mari Energies holds 44%, and Dewan Petroleum (Pvt.) Limited (DPL) owns the remaining 10% stake.

Tibri-1 is the first exploratory well drilled in the Kalchas South Block. The well was spudded on November 11, 2025, and drilled to a total depth of 7,170 feet, the filing said.

Initial testing of the Dunghan/Sui Main Limestone (SML) formation showed promising results. The well flowed 11 million standard cubic feet per day (MMSCFD) of gas at a 64/64″ choke with a wellhead flowing pressure of 561 psig, and 6.5 MMSCFD at a 32/64″ choke with a pressure of 1,161 psig. Further testing is underway to evaluate the well’s potential fully, the company added.

Mari Energies noted that the area had remained dormant for a long period due to security challenges. However, after the joint venture acquired DPL’s working interest in July 2023, exploration activities resumed, leading to the discovery of Tibri-1.

The company said the discovery highlights the joint venture’s commitment to expanding Pakistan’s domestic hydrocarbon resources and strengthening the country’s energy supply base.
